1a. Type the @ sign followed by (with no space) their username. Once you start typing the username, a drop-down list should appear with potential completions and you can select the desired user. Example:
@beatdat
You can also highlight, copy & paste their username from next to their avatar at the top of a message. Example:
beatdat
1b. Some options here as well...
Selecting the Reply link at the lower right of their post will embed a collapsed version of that post in your reply. Then when previewed or submitted, clicking on their username at the top of the embedded post will take you to the original post. Example:
